Uhhh at the risk of sounding dumb… what are actives?
Ingredients like retinol, retinoids, glycolic acid, lactic acid, salicylic acid, other polyhydroxy acids. They're good for your skin barrier, but can cause irritation if used too much or too often and will likely be irritating if used underneath an occlusive layer of petrolatum. So on nights you want to slug, stay away from products that have these ingredients. Stick to neutral serums or moisturizers like vanicream products which are well known for sensitive skin types because they don't have any actives.
